Episode 7 | Nail Psoriasis as Coronary Risk Factor and Terbinafine 10% Solution for Onychomycosis

Clippings: The Official Podcast of the Council for Nail Disorders by Council for Nail Disorders

Episode notes

Episode 7 features Dr. April Schachtel and Dr. Katherine Stiff reviewing the following recent publications:

  • Colunga-Pedraza IJ et al. Nail involvement in psoriatic arthritis patients is an independent risk factor for carotid plaque. Annals of the Rheumatic Diseases Published Online First: 24 June 2021.

  • Gupta AK et al. Terbinafine 10% solution (MOB-015) in the treatment of mild to moderate distal subungual onychomycosis: A randomized, multicenter, double-blind, vehicle-controlled phase 3 study. J Am Acad Dermatol. 2021;85(1):95-104.
